Résumé
Le traitement actuel du diabète est efficace dans la baisse de la glycémie, cependant le contrôle adéquat quotidien de la glycémie est très difficile à atteindre dans la plupart des cas, ce qui conduit à long terme à l’émergence de complications très sérieuses. L’essor récent de la phytothérapie offre une opportunité pour trouver des molécules naturelles susceptibles d’exercer des effets bénéfiques sur la régulation du métabolisme glucidique en évitant les effets secondaires des substances synthétiques. Le Maroc, riche par sa biodiversité et son climat, est une plate-forme géographique très importante qui mérite d’être explorée dans le domaine de la recherche de molécules hypoglycémiantes originaires de plantes qui ont pour longtemps servi à une grande tranche de population comme moyen incontournable de médication. L’objectif de ce travail est de présenter des données actuelles sur l’utilisation des plantes médicinales dans le traitement du diabète au Maroc.
Abstract
The current treatment of diabetes is efficacious as far as the decrease of glycaemia is concerned, however, effective control of glycaemia is difficult to achieve in many cases and leads to the emergence of serious long term complications. Phytotherapy offers a valuable opportunity to discover new natural molecules with beneficial effects on glucose homeostasis and without any of the side effects currently observed in modern therapy. Morocco, with its rich biodiversity and climate represents an important geographical field for exploration with regard to hypoglycaemic molecules found in plants that had for a long time represented a source of medication for a large proportion of the population. The objective of this study is to present current data on the use of hypoglycaemic plants for treating diabetes mellitus in Morocco.
